Patents by Inventor Hajime Futatsugi

Hajime Futatsugi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10346427
    Abstract: In a method for writing data having been subjected to transaction processing in a synchronization source database to data in a synchronization destination database, a synchronization processing management unit of the synchronization destination database requests, as synchronization target data, first data that is a part of the data having been subjected to the transaction processing from the synchronization source database, receives at least the first data from the synchronization source database, performs first synchronization processing on the first data in a cache memory, and performs second synchronization processing on second data, in the synchronization destination database, which has been processed in a same transaction as a transaction in which the first data has been processed in the synchronization source database.
    Type: Grant
    Filed: October 1, 2014
    Date of Patent: July 9, 2019
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Patent number: 9552443
    Abstract: An information processing apparatus includes a search execution unit configured to execute a search on the basis of a search condition, an item specification unit configured to specify particular data as an item from data included in a result of the search executed by the search execution unit on the basis of the search condition, an item storage unit configured to store the item specified by the item specification unit in a storage apparatus, a search result generation unit configured to generate a search result without data overlap on the basis of data included in a result of a search executed by the search execution unit on the basis of a new search condition and the item stored in the storage apparatus, and a search result display unit configured to display the search result generated by the search result generation unit.
    Type: Grant
    Filed: September 3, 2009
    Date of Patent: January 24, 2017
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Publication number: 20160377446
    Abstract: The number of times of designation with respect to a position on a map is counted, and the number of times of designation is managed in association with the position and the map. If the number of times of designation with respect to a position of interest on the map exceeds a threshold value, a position that is managed in association with a large-area map including an area shown by the map is specified, and an object in the specified position on the large-area map is highlighted on the large-area map.
    Type: Application
    Filed: September 7, 2016
    Publication date: December 29, 2016
    Inventor: Hajime Futatsugi
  • Publication number: 20160349972
    Abstract: There is provided a data browse apparatus that can improve visibility by controlling a display content regarding data having a high degree of correlation with an instruction direction among pieces of data on a browse screen. The data browse apparatus includes a data direction acquisition unit configured to acquire a direction indicated by data expressing a path as a data direction, an instruction direction acquisition unit configured to acquire a direction in a space of the data as an instruction direction, a relationship acquisition unit configured to acquire a relationship between the data direction and the instruction direction, and a display control unit configured to perform display control so as to make a difference in display content among a plurality of pieces of the data based on the relationship.
    Type: Application
    Filed: May 26, 2016
    Publication date: December 1, 2016
    Inventors: Kunihiko Miyoshi, Hajime Futatsugi
  • Patent number: 9471911
    Abstract: An information processing apparatus and method composites and displays a map image at a designated scale and an object associated with the map image at the designated scale. The apparatus and method count the number of times of designation with respect to a position on a map, and manage the number of times of designation in association with the position and the map. If the number of times of designation with respect to a position of interest on the map exceeds a threshold value, a position that is managed in association with a large-area map including an area shown by the map is specified, and an object in the specified position on the large-area map is highlighted on the large-area map.
    Type: Grant
    Filed: March 5, 2013
    Date of Patent: October 18, 2016
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Patent number: 9189499
    Abstract: An information processing apparatus acquires a first metadata value of first metadata from a content to be assigned metadata, performs a first search from contents by the first metadata using the first metadata value as a search condition, acquires a second metadata value of second metadata different from the first metadata from one or more contents included in a set of a result of the first search, performs a second search from the contents by the second metadata using the second metadata value as a search condition, finds a degree of similarity between the set of the result of the first search and a set of a result of the second search, and assigns, according to the degree of similarity, the second metadata value as metadata of the content to be assigned metadata.
    Type: Grant
    Filed: October 1, 2010
    Date of Patent: November 17, 2015
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Publication number: 20150095280
    Abstract: In a method for writing data having been subjected to transaction processing in a synchronization source database to data in a synchronization destination database, a synchronization processing management unit of the synchronization destination database requests, as synchronization target data, first data that is a part of the data having been subjected to the transaction processing from the synchronization source database, receives at least the first data from the synchronization source database, performs first synchronization processing on the first data in a cache memory, and performs second synchronization processing on second data, in the synchronization destination database, which has been processed in a same transaction as a transaction in which the first data has been processed in the synchronization source database.
    Type: Application
    Filed: October 1, 2014
    Publication date: April 2, 2015
    Inventor: Hajime Futatsugi
  • Patent number: 8553249
    Abstract: A printing apparatus connectable to a recording apparatus that records data on a recording medium. An obtaining unit, when the printing apparatus is connected to the recording apparatus, obtains, from the recording apparatus, attribute information regarding data recordable on the recording medium. A printing unit prints in a printable area of the recording medium using the attribute information. An identifier reading unit reads, from the recording medium, an identifier capable of individually identifying the recording medium. A management unit manages the attribute information associated with the identifier.
    Type: Grant
    Filed: July 6, 2006
    Date of Patent: October 8, 2013
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Publication number: 20130241953
    Abstract: The number of times of designation with respect to a position on a map is counted, and the number of times of designation is managed in association with the position and the map. If the number of times of designation with respect to a position of interest on the map exceeds a threshold value, a position that is managed in association with a large-area map including an area shown by the map is specified, and an object in the specified position on the large-area map is highlighted on the large-area map.
    Type: Application
    Filed: March 5, 2013
    Publication date: September 19, 2013
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i
  • Patent number: 8417742
    Abstract: A folder relationship holding unit (305) manages the relationship only between parents and children of files and/or folders arranged in a hierarchical structure. An operation target of the files and/or folders managed by the folder relationship holding unit (305) is operated in a locked state. To reflect the operation result on each apparatus that manages information identical to that managed by the folder relationship holding unit (305), the apparatus is notified of the operation result at a designated timing.
    Type: Grant
    Filed: February 4, 2010
    Date of Patent: April 9, 2013
    Assignee: Canon Kabushiki Kaisha
    Inventors: Fumiaki Itoh, Tsutomu Inose, Hiroyuki Nagai, Tomoyuki Shimizu, Hajime Futatsugi, Hidenori Ishiwata
  • Patent number: 8301606
    Abstract: In a data management method using a hierarchical folder structure where an item such as data or a folder can be registered in multiple folders, attribute information is appended to each relational data piece that represents a pair of a child item that is either data or a folder registered in a folder and a parent folder in which the child item has been registered. This attribute information is referred to when a single child item has been registered in multiple parent folders, in order to select one of the multiple parent folders. By selecting a relational data piece based on the attribute information so that each child item can be registered in a single parent folder, at least part of the hierarchical folder structure is converted into a tree structure where a single child item belongs to a single folder.
    Type: Grant
    Filed: January 15, 2010
    Date of Patent: October 30, 2012
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Patent number: 8145580
    Abstract: Data elements are classified into a plurality of folders in accordance with classification conditions on the basis of each of a plurality of metadata elements. Data elements in each of the folders are further classified into a plurality of folders on the basis of a metadata element different from the metadata element associated with the folder. This operation is repeated in accordance with the number of metadata elements to organize a folder system having a tree structure. When a classification result based on a given one of the metadata elements is present in only one folder in the organized folder system and is not present in other folders arranged in the same layer as that of the folder, the other folders are deleted.
    Type: Grant
    Filed: June 11, 2008
    Date of Patent: March 27, 2012
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Patent number: 8140553
    Abstract: This invention allows obtaining desired data even at a copy destination by only a simple copy operation irrespective of differences of search functions upon copying a search folder to an external device. This invention is directed to an information processing method in an information processing apparatus connected to an external device. In this method, when an instruction to copy a search folder to the external device is input, whether or not the search conditions of the designated search folder are executable at the external device is determined, a folder to be transmitted to the external device is generated, data are searched based on a search condition which is determined not to be executable. After data IDs are set in the generated folder so that the obtained by the search data can be acquired via the generated folder, the folder is transmitted to the external device.
    Type: Grant
    Filed: October 23, 2008
    Date of Patent: March 20, 2012
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Publication number: 20110082886
    Abstract: An information processing apparatus acquires a first metadata value of first metadata from a content to be assigned metadata, performs a first search from contents by the first metadata using the first metadata value as a search condition, acquires a second metadata value of second metadata different from the first metadata from one or more contents included in a set of a result of the first search, performs a second search from the contents by the second metadata using the second metadata value as a search condition, finds a degree of similarity between the set of the result of the first search and a set of a result of the second search, and assigns, according to the degree of similarity, the second metadata value as metadata of the content to be assigned metadata.
    Type: Application
    Filed: October 1, 2010
    Publication date: April 7, 2011
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i
  • Publication number: 20100198874
    Abstract: In a data management method using a hierarchical folder structure where an item such as data or a folder can be registered in multiple folders, attribute information is appended to each relational data piece that represents a pair of a child item that is either data or a folder registered in a folder and a parent folder in which the child item has been registered. This attribute information is referred to when a single child item has been registered in multiple parent folders, in order to select one of the multiple parent folders. By selecting a relational data piece based on the attribute information so that each child item can be registered in a single parent folder, at least part of the hierarchical folder structure is converted into a tree structure where a single child item belongs to a single folder.
    Type: Application
    Filed: January 15, 2010
    Publication date: August 5, 2010
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i
  • Publication number: 20100146017
    Abstract: A folder relationship holding unit (305) manages the relationship only between parents and children of files and/or folders arranged in a hierarchical structure. An operation target of the files and/or folders managed by the folder relationship holding unit (305) is operated in a locked state. To reflect the operation result on each apparatus that manages information identical to that managed by the folder relationship holding unit (305), the apparatus is notified of the operation result at a designated timing.
    Type: Application
    Filed: February 4, 2010
    Publication date: June 10, 2010
    Applicant: CANON KABUSHIKI KAISHA
    Inventors: Fumiaki Itoh, Tsutomu Inose, Hiroyuki Nagai, Tomoyuki Shimizu, Hajime Futatsugi, Hidenori Ishiwata
  • Publication number: 20100076975
    Abstract: An information processing apparatus includes a search execution unit configured to execute a search on the basis of a search condition, an item specification unit configured to specify particular data as an item from data included in a result of the search executed by the search execution unit on the basis of the search condition, an item storage unit configured to store the item specified by the item specification unit in a storage apparatus, a search result generation unit configured to generate a search result without data overlap on the basis of data included in a result of a search executed by the search execution unit on the basis of a new search condition and the item stored in the storage apparatus, and a search result display unit configured to display the search result generated by the search result generation unit.
    Type: Application
    Filed: September 3, 2009
    Publication date: March 25, 2010
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i
  • Patent number: 7580934
    Abstract: An information processing apparatus for managing an access right to an object includes a storage unit configured to store objects in a hierarchical structure and a determination unit configured to determine an access right to a low-level object. The low-level object has inheritance information indicating whether or not the low-level object inherits an access right from an object at a higher level. The determination unit determines the access right to the low-level object for the user based on an access right to the low-level object set for the user if the inheritance information of the low-level object is set as “not inherited.” Alternatively, the determination unit determines the access right to the low-level object based on an access right to the lowest-level object of the objects at a level higher than the low-level object if the inheritance information of the low-level object is set as “inherited.
    Type: Grant
    Filed: September 6, 2005
    Date of Patent: August 25, 2009
    Assignee: Canon Kabushiki Kaisha
    Inventor: Hajime Futatsugi
  • Publication number: 20090132495
    Abstract: This invention allows obtaining desired data even at a copy destination by only a simple copy operation irrespective of differences of search functions upon copying a search folder to an external device. This invention is directed to an information processing method in an information processing apparatus connected to an external device. In this method, when an instruction to copy a search folder to the external device is input, whether or not the search conditions of the designated search folder are executable at the external device is determined, a folder to be transmitted to the external device is generated, data are searched based on a search condition which is determined not to be executable. After data IDs are set in the generated folder so that the obtained by the search data can be acquired via the generated folder, the folder is transmitted to the external device.
    Type: Application
    Filed: October 23, 2008
    Publication date: May 21, 2009
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i
  • Publication number: 20080313107
    Abstract: Data elements are classified into a plurality of folders in accordance with classification conditions on the basis of each of a plurality of metadata elements. Data elements in each of the folders are further classified into a plurality of folders on the basis of a metadata element different from the metadata element associated with the folder. This operation is repeated in accordance with the number of metadata elements to organize a folder system having a tree structure. When a classification result based on a given one of the metadata elements is present in only one folder in the organized folder system and is not present in other folders arranged in the same layer as that of the folder, the other folders are deleted.
    Type: Application
    Filed: June 11, 2008
    Publication date: December 18, 2008
    Applicant: CANON KABUSHIKI KAISHA
    Inventor: Hajime Futatsugi